- ChrispinApr 09, 2025 · a year agoBlockchain consensus plays a crucial role in the world of digital currencies. It refers to the mechanism by which multiple participants in a decentralized network agree on the validity of transactions. This consensus is achieved through various algorithms, such as Proof of Work (PoW) or Proof of Stake (PoS). By reaching a consensus, blockchain networks ensure the integrity and immutability of transaction data, making it extremely difficult for malicious actors to tamper with the records. This consensus mechanism enhances the security and reliability of digital currency transactions, providing users with trust and confidence in the system.
- Sadık Mert DincelFeb 20, 2024 · 2 years agoBlockchain consensus is like a digital referee that ensures fair play in the world of digital currencies. It acts as a consensus-building mechanism among network participants, validating and confirming transactions. This process helps prevent double-spending and ensures that only valid transactions are added to the blockchain. By achieving consensus, blockchain networks create a transparent and trustless environment where transactions can be executed securely and efficiently. It's like having a decentralized governing body that maintains the integrity of the digital currency ecosystem.
- Ojas PatelSep 14, 2022 · 4 years agoIn the world of digital currencies, blockchain consensus is the key to maintaining a secure and reliable transaction ledger. It ensures that all participants in the network agree on the validity of transactions and prevents any single entity from having control over the system. Blockchain consensus algorithms, such as Proof of Work or Proof of Stake, provide a decentralized and democratic way of reaching agreement. This consensus mechanism not only enhances security but also promotes decentralization, making digital currencies resistant to censorship and manipulation. It's a fundamental building block that enables the trustless and transparent nature of digital currency transactions.
